Seoul, March 27, 2020. Ho-sung Song is appointed the new global President and CEO of Kia Motors. After having occupied the position of Head of the Global Operations Division, Song took over this role from Han-woo Park, who stepped down after six years as head of the Korean car manufacturer (Kia Motors, 2020a). At the time of the handover, Kia Motors was facing big challenges. After having reported a drop of 73% in its operating profit in 2017, the company never went back to its 2016-profit level despite slightly growing revenues (Kia Motors, n.d.a). Furthermore, Kia Motors’ share price dropped significantly over the years, reaching a value of KRW 44,350 at the end of 2019, almost half of that of seven years before (KRX, n.d.). In addition, new trends, regulations, technologies, competitors, and consumer behaviors disrupted the whole automotive industry, creating an uncertain environment for car manufacturers…
